PowerPoint Viewer
Just got a new computer with Vista as O.S. The package did not come with
PowerPoint Viewer so I downloaded the 7.0 PowerPoint from Microsoft. Figured
at this point I could open any PowerPoint attachment. Wrong, it will only
allow me to open if I save it to a folder and then go and click on PowerPoint
Icon and then it shows the attachments I have saved and then if I click one
it will open. Long process to open something that under XP opens by just
clicking on the attachment. I can not open using the "open with" feature
either. What could be the problem and what can I do to correct this.
Thanks.

Re: PowerPoint Viewer
Your email is in the wrong 'zone' for that. Go to your Mail options, and
look for a security tab. You are probably in the 'restricted zone', and
would have to be in the 'Internet zone' to do that. (Not that I recommend
that)
